murat temucin

I tried the chicken gyro rice plate and was genuinely impressed.For just $12.79 you get a generous portion with three fresh sides 2 favorful dressing and warm pita bread.Everything tasted incredibly fresh and well-seasoned.Great value for the quality snd portion size.Im excited to come back and explore more of the menu.
